Sunday out of Maquam

Tough bite beautiful day. There is a rather large algae bloom going on. With limited visibility we only boated 7 pike. The size of the fish were down also. The few fish we found were out 3-4' deeper than the prior couple of weeks. I'll give it a last shot on Friday , but then it's stick & string...
